Web11 de nov. de 2024 · Airbnb will charge hosts a 20% service fee on every experience offered. The calculation is based on the total price of the experience and, like Airbnb accommodations, is automatically deducted from the host payout. Web5 de jun. de 2024 · 5 Things Good Guests Always Do. 1. Arrive and leave on time. Unlike a hotel, your vacation rental doesn’t have a 24-hour concierge — just a host who’s probably organizing their day around your check-in schedule. Be mindful of the listing’s check-in and check-out times, and send your host a message if you’re running late.
